プロジェクト

全般

プロフィール

統計
| リビジョン:

h-you / branches / src / ProcessManagement / ProcessManagement / DataModel / DepositDataDetail.cs @ 261

履歴 | 表示 | アノテート | ダウンロード (5.59 KB)

1 51 bit
using System;
2
using System.Collections.Generic;
3
using System.Linq;
4
using System.Text;
5
using System.Threading.Tasks;
6
7
namespace ProcessManagement.DataModel
8
{
9
    /// <summary>
10
    /// 入金明細データ
11
    /// </summary>
12
    public class DepositDataDetail
13
    {
14
        #region メンバ変数
15 185 bit
        private int m_OrderersDivision = 0;                         // 発注者区分
16
        private int m_OrderersCode = 0;                             // 発注者コード
17
        private string m_TargetDate = string.Empty;                 // 対象年月
18
        private int m_RequestNo = 0;                                // 請求No
19
        private int m_OrderNo = 0;                                  // 受付番号
20
        private long m_DepositAmount = 0;                           // 入金金額
21
        private long m_DiscountAmount = 0;                          // 値引き金額
22
        private long m_CnstrPrice = 0;                              // 協力金
23
        private long m_Fees = 0;                                    // 手数料
24
        private long m_OtherAdjustments = 0;                        // その他調整
25
        private long m_DifferenceAmount = 0;                        // 差分
26
        private int m_ConfirmationPersonCode = 0;                   // 承認担当者コード
27
        private DateTime m_ConfirmationDate = DateTime.MinValue;    // 担当者承認日付
28
        private int m_ConfirmationEndFlg = 0;                       // 承認完了フラグ
29
        private string m_Note = string.Empty;                       // 備考
30
        private DateTime m_EntryDate = DateTime.Now;                // 登録年月日
31
        private DateTime m_UpdateDate = DateTime.Now;               // 更新年月日
32 51 bit
        #endregion
33
34
        #region コンストラクタ
35
        #endregion
36
37
        #region プロパティ
38
        /// <summary>
39
        /// 発注者区分
40
        /// </summary>
41
        public int OrderersDivision
42
        {
43
            get { return m_OrderersDivision; }
44
            set { m_OrderersDivision = value; }
45
        }
46
47
        /// <summary>
48
        /// 発注者コード
49
        /// </summary>
50
        public int OrderersCode
51
        {
52
            get { return m_OrderersCode; }
53
            set { m_OrderersCode = value; }
54
        }
55
56
        /// <summary>
57
        /// 対象年月
58
        /// </summary>
59
        public string TargetDate
60
        {
61
            get { return m_TargetDate; }
62
            set { m_TargetDate = value; }
63
        }
64
65
        /// <summary>
66
        /// 請求No
67
        /// </summary>
68
        public int RequestNo
69
        {
70
            get { return m_RequestNo; }
71
            set { m_RequestNo = value; }
72
        }
73
74
        /// <summary>
75
        /// 受付番号
76
        /// </summary>
77
        public int OrderNo
78
        {
79
            get { return m_OrderNo; }
80
            set { m_OrderNo = value; }
81
        }
82
83
        /// <summary>
84
        /// 入金金額
85
        /// </summary>
86 88 bit
        public long DepositAmount
87 51 bit
        {
88
            get { return m_DepositAmount; }
89
            set { m_DepositAmount = value; }
90
        }
91
92
        /// <summary>
93
        /// 値引き金額
94
        /// </summary>
95 88 bit
        public long DiscountAmount
96 51 bit
        {
97
            get { return m_DiscountAmount; }
98
            set { m_DiscountAmount = value; }
99
        }
100
101
        /// <summary>
102
        /// 協力金
103
        /// </summary>
104 88 bit
        public long CnstrPrice
105 51 bit
        {
106
            get { return m_CnstrPrice; }
107
            set { m_CnstrPrice = value; }
108
        }
109
110
        /// <summary>
111
        /// 手数料
112
        /// </summary>
113 88 bit
        public long Fees
114 51 bit
        {
115
            get { return m_Fees; }
116
            set { m_Fees = value; }
117
        }
118
119
        /// <summary>
120
        /// その他調整
121
        /// </summary>
122 88 bit
        public long OtherAdjustments
123 51 bit
        {
124
            get { return m_OtherAdjustments; }
125
            set { m_OtherAdjustments = value; }
126
        }
127
128
        /// <summary>
129 185 bit
        /// 差額金額
130 51 bit
        /// </summary>
131 185 bit
        public long DifferenceAmount
132 51 bit
        {
133 185 bit
            get { return m_DifferenceAmount; }
134
            set { m_DifferenceAmount = value; }
135 51 bit
        }
136
137
        /// <summary>
138 185 bit
        /// 確認担当者コード
139 51 bit
        /// </summary>
140 185 bit
        public int ConfirmationPersonCode
141 51 bit
        {
142 185 bit
            get { return m_ConfirmationPersonCode; }
143
            set { m_ConfirmationPersonCode = value; }
144 51 bit
        }
145
146
        /// <summary>
147 185 bit
        /// 担当者確認日付
148 51 bit
        /// </summary>
149 185 bit
        public DateTime ConfirmationDate
150 51 bit
        {
151 185 bit
            get { return m_ConfirmationDate; }
152
            set { m_ConfirmationDate = value; }
153 51 bit
        }
154
155
        /// <summary>
156 185 bit
        /// 確認完了フラグ
157 51 bit
        /// </summary>
158 185 bit
        public int ConfirmationEndFlg
159 51 bit
        {
160 185 bit
            get { return m_ConfirmationEndFlg; }
161
            set { m_ConfirmationEndFlg = value; }
162 51 bit
        }
163
164
        /// <summary>
165 185 bit
        /// 備考
166
        /// </summary>
167
        public string Note
168
        {
169
            get { return m_Note; }
170
            set { m_Note = value; }
171
        }
172
173
        /// <summary>
174 51 bit
        /// 登録年月日
175
        /// </summary>
176
        public DateTime EntryDate
177
        {
178
            get { return m_EntryDate; }
179
            set { m_EntryDate = value; }
180
        }
181
182
        /// <summary>
183
        /// 更新年月日
184
        /// </summary>
185
        public DateTime UpdateDate
186
        {
187
            get { return m_UpdateDate; }
188
            set { m_UpdateDate = value; }
189
        }
190
        #endregion
191
192
    }
193
}